Huldrebreen is a glacier in Oscar II Land at Spitsbergen, Svalbard. It is surrounded by the mountains of Huldrehatten, Huldrefjellet and Bytingen, west in the mountainous district of Trollheimen.[1] Huldrebreen and Austgötabreen are located north of the glacier complex of Eidembreen.[2] The glacier is named after Hulder in Scandinavian folklore.
